Abstract

Official abstract text for this publication.

An embodiment provides an electronic device comprising: a body; a battery disposed within the body; a first portion extending from the body; a second portion extending from the body; and a charging coil disposed within at least the first portion and the second portion that charges the battery. Other aspects are described and claimed.

First claim

Opening claim text (preview).

What is claimed is: 1. An electronic device comprising: a body; a plurality of electronic components disposed within the body, wherein the plurality of electronic components comprise a battery; a first portion extending from the body; a second portion extending from the body; a shielding layer covering the plurality of electronic components disposed within the body; and a charging coil disposed within the body, the first portion, and the second portion that charges the battery, wherein the charging coil is positioned at an inner peripheral edge of the first portion and the second portion; wherein a conductive line of the charging coil has a deformable helical shape and surrounds the inner peripheral edge of the first portion and the second portion, the conductive line being formed from a plurality of parallel, butt-jointed terminals located inside the conductive line. 2. The electronic device of claim 1 , wherein the first portion and the second portion attach to one another at an ends thereof distal to the body. 3. The electronic device of claim 2 , wherein an annular space is formed by the body, the first portion and the second portion when the first portion is attached with the second portion. 4. The electronic device of claim 3 , wherein the first portion and the second portion form a watch band. 5. The electronic device of claim 2 , wherein the first portion and the second portion attach via an interface. 6. The electronic device of claim 1 , wherein the first portion and the second portion are deformable. 7. The electronic device according to claim 1 , wherein the body comprises a main-board. 8. The electronic device of claim 1 , wherein the electronic device is a smart watch. 9. A method, comprising: attaching a first deformable portion and a second deformable portion to a body of an electronic device, wherein the body comprises a plurality of electronic components, the plurality of electronic components comprising a battery; and connecting a charging coil disposed in the body, the first portion and the second portion to a charging chip within the body of the electronic device, wherein the charging coil is positioned at an inner peripheral edge of the first portion and the second portion; wherein a conductive line of the charging coil has a deformable helical shape and surrounds the inner peripheral edge of the first portion and the second portion, the conductive line being formed from a plurality of parallel, butt-jointed terminals located inside the conductive line. 10. The method of claim 9 , wherein the first portion and the second portion attach to one another at an ends thereof distal to the body. 11. The method of claim 10 , wherein an annular space is formed by the body, the first portion and the second portion when the first portion is attached with the second portion. 12. The method of claim 9 , wherein the first portion and the second portion attach via an interface. 13. The method of claim 9 , wherein the first portion and the second portion form a watch band. 14. The method of claim 9 , wherein the body comprises a main-board attached to the charging chip. 15. The method of claim 9 , comprising providing a shielding layer. 16. The method of claim 15 , wherein the providing comprises disposing the shielding layer within the body of the electronic device. 17. A system, comprising: an electronic device comprising a body; a battery disposed within the body; a first portion extending from the body; a second portion extending from the body; and a charging coil disposed within the body, the first portion and the second portion that charges the battery, wherein the charging coil is positioned at an inner peripheral edge of the first portion and the second portion; and a charger that transfers a charge to the charging coil; wherein the body comprises a plurality of electronic components, the plurality of electronic components comprising a battery; wherein a conductive line of the charging coil has a deformable helical shape and surrounds the inner peripheral edge of the first portion and the second portion, the conductive line being formed from a plurality of parallel, butt-jointed terminals located inside the conductive line. 18. The system of claim 17 , wherein the charger transfers the charge wirelessly. 19. The system of claim 17 , wherein the electronic device is a smart watch.
